Review the measured results and identify the part and change most directly supported by the evidence.
| Feature | CAD target | Measured average | Observed result |
|---|---|---|---|
| Body inside diameter | 40.00 mm | 40.05 mm | Within expectation |
| Coupler outside diameter | 39.70 mm | 40.02 mm | Too tight |
| Fin angle | 90.0° | 89.8° | Acceptable |
